Consuming only 700 calories a day is dangerously low and may lead to serious health issues like malnutrition, muscle loss, and weakened immune function. It is crucial to achieve a balanced diet with adequate caloric intake based on your age, gender, and activity level. Always consult with a healthcare provider before making drastic changes to your diet to ensure your nutritional needs are met safely.

  1. What are the risks of a 700 calorie diet? A 700 calorie diet can lead to malnutrition, muscle loss, and weakened immune system, posing serious health risks.
  2. How many calories should I eat for a balanced diet? Caloric needs vary by age, gender, and activity level. It's important to consult a healthcare provider for personalized advice.
  3. Can I lose weight on a very low calorie diet? While weight loss may occur, it can lead to severe health consequences and is not sustainable in the long term.
  4. What constitutes a balanced diet? A balanced diet includes a variety of foods ensuring all essential nutrients are consumed to maintain overall health.
